Do You Grind Your Teeth At Night?
Do you wake up with sore jaw or maybe a headache? If you do, it could be a sign that you are grinding your teeth while you sleep. Many people grind their teeth during their sleep and they don’t even know it. Over time, this can cause sever damage to your teeth and it is something that needs to be corrected.
One of the causes of bruxism is thought to be stress but there could be many other reasons as well. Whether it is stress or something else, it is extremely difficult to break a habit that you dont even know you are doing. So many people suffer from a mild case of bruxism that it is never looked into unless their dentist notices.
Most dentists will recommend a teeth guard but that will not solve the problem and only protect the teeth. The dilemma you face is whether you want to spend money on something that you may have to wear the rest of your life or whether you want to attack the problem and find a way to stop it. If you really want to fix the situation, it is best to discover why you are grinding your teeth and this will help you better figure out a remedy.
Most people suffer from bruxism because of stress and that is the first place to start looking when you set out to cure it. However, stress is not always the main component and many people grind their teeth that are not stressed at all. This is what makes bruxism very hard to cure: the fact that in one person it may be stress and in another person it may be stress combined with some other factor or maybe not stress at all.
If you can identify what your stress is and find a way to eliminate it, you could have found a cure for your bruxism. Many people go to a therapist to discover if there are any things going on that they are not aware of that could be causing it. Short of finding a cure, getting a mouth guard to wear at night is the best course of action. Your dentist will gladly make a mouth guard for you but it may be on the expensive side.
